Ceylon Investment PLC proposes to repurchase up to 1,800,014 ordinary shares at Rs.203.33 each for a total of Rs.365,996,846.62, with the offer expected to run 2–23 Sep subject to regulatory concurrence. The Board approved the buyback, signed a Certificate of Solvency and says its Articles permit the repurchase without shareholder approval.

About Ceylon Guardian Investment Trust PLC
Ceylon Guardian Investment Trust PLC is the holding company of the investment business of the Carson Cumberbatch Group and operates as an investment house managing portfolios of multiple asset classes for differing groups of investors. It focuses on building equity stakes in well-run Sri Lankan companies and on high-quality fixed income placements to support wealth creation for its stakeholders. As at 31 March 2025 the Guardian Group's total investment portfolio was reported at Rs. 34.25 Bn. The company primarily operates in Sri Lanka and holds positions across listed sectors through both active portfolio management and strategic long-term stakes.

First Capital Research: aggregate earnings of 271 listed companies fell 11.4% YoY in the March 2026 quarter (third straight quarter), but underlying earnings rose 30.1% YoY after adjusting for major one-offs. Food, Beverage & Tobacco dragged the aggregate result while retailing and telecom posted strong gains (e.g. UML, DIAL, SLTL, SINS).
Chinthaka Jayaweera was appointed Independent Non-Executive Director of Ceylon Guardian Investment Trust (GUAR.N0000) and Ceylon Investment PLC (CINV.N0000). He previously led internal audit at A.P. Moller Maersk and has held independent directorships at Bukit Darah, Carson Cumberbatch, Equity Two and Pegasus Hotels.
Aggregate profits of 273 listed companies fell 12% YoY to Rs.176.5 billion in Sep-25, ending a seven-quarter growth streak. Banks (Rs.52bn, +39% YoY) and diversified financials (Rs.39bn, +112% YoY) underpinned a QoQ rebound, while food, beverage & tobacco and capital goods posted steep declines.
MSCI added seven Sri Lankan companies—GUAR, DIMO, JAT, KHL, RIL, PARQ and VFIN—to its Frontier Markets Small Cap Indexes, raising Sri Lanka's index coverage to 12 constituents as of the market close on 26 August; no Sri Lankan removals were made in the review.

Banks & Finance sector: what is happening
Last 30 days to Aug 4, 2026Regulatory tightening dominated banks/finance as Cabinet named the SEC to regulate virtual asset service providers within a CBSL/FIU/IRD framework and approved a 2026-2030 national AML policy. The FIU flagged long-running trade-based money laundering via phantom imports, after probes found about $715m in fraudulent remittances. CBSL kept LTV caps on vehicle and gold loans. Services PMI signaled June expansion led by financial services.
